Here: Liberty Towers to Receive First HydraStax(R) Fuel Cell
BEAVERTON, Ore., Oct 27, 2010 (BUSINESS WIRE) -- Hydra Fuel Cell Corporation, a wholly owned subsidiary of American Security Resources Corporation (OTCQB: ARSC), announced today that Liberty Towers, LLC will be receiving the first commercial installation of a HydraStax(R) fuel cell.
Jim Twedt, CEO of Hydra, stated, "We are working with Liberty on the pre-delivery site engineering and installation details right now and expect to ship sometime in the next several weeks, with installation to follow shortly thereafter."
Michael Hofe, President and COO of Liberty Towers, stated, "Liberty is excited to work with Hydra Fuel Cell Corporation and their PEM based fuel cell product, as part of our off-grid solutions program, to select back-up and primary power solutions to support tower operations during emergency conditions or as an overall grid replacement for remote tower sites that have no reasonable possibility of securing grid power. We believe Hydra's highly scalable fuel cell solutions can provide us the ability to cost effectively employ off-grid solutions, while controlling costs."
Liberty Towers, LLC
Liberty Towers is a communications tower company which develops, acquires and manages wireless communications towers in the continental United States. Liberty is headquartered in the greater Washington, DC area. For more information, please see: www.libertytowers.com
Hydra Fuel Cell Corporation
Hydra Fuel Cell Corp. is developing high volume, mass producible hydrogen fuel cells. Hydra is a wholly owned subsidiary of American Security Resources Corporation. For more information, please see: www.americansecurityresources.com
